“ Types of Artificial Light. Now that we've learned about light and the basic fundamentals in this lesson, we'll go over the main groups of artificial lights that are available. Types of Artificial Light Tungsten Hot Light First up is the OG light, the Tungsten Hot Light, which is the original movie light that came around probably 100 years ago or more. It's tungsten yellow, 3200K balanced. It's hot, it's very inefficient, it takes too much power for the amount of light it puts out. For a long time, it was all there was but things have improved.
